Color Meaning and Usage

#B2CDB7 is a pastel green color with RGB values of 178, 205, 183 and HSL of 131°, 21%, 75%. This green hue evokes nature and harmony, making it suitable for often used for branding and logos.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#B2CDB7 is #CDB2C8,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#BACDB2.
